Your bike probably squeaks going anywhere from 10mph up to 35 or even 40mph.
That is because the front axle is waaaaaaaayyyyyyyyyy to tight.You need to loosen it up.
The best way is to put it up on stands,and remove the axle completely. You then want to lube all the parts that rest on the axle with something like white lithium grease(it normally comes in a spray can so it is easy) you then reinstall the axle and just snug it down some.The torque spec is like 65ft lbs. start there.But I personally found this is still too tight.
You can also just loosen it and re torque it to spec.
